SEC announces 2025 football leadership council

The SEC announced the 2025 members of the Football Leadership Council on Thursday.
The 16 athletes from across the conference will convene in Birmingham this Friday and Saturday for their annual offseason meetings.
The purpose of the council and the annual meeting is to provide the student-athletes with additional opportunities to engage with staff from the conference offices. They have held an annual leadership council meeting since the conference’s inception in 1932. Per the SEC’s official website, there are several items on the agenda for the weekend’s meetings.
The leadership council will meet with Commissioner Greg Sankey, review SEC and NCAA legislative items, discuss rules of the game with officials, and review SEC student-athlete engagement opportunities.
Here are the 2025 Football Leadership Members by school
Tim Keenan III, Alabama
Fernando Carmona, Arkansas
Keldric Faulk, Auburn
Hayden Hansen, Florida
CJ Allen, Georgia
Josh Kattus, Kentucky
Braden Augustus, LSU
TJ Dottery, Ole Miss
Marlon Hauck, Mississippi State
Daylan Carnell, Missouri
R Mason Thomas, Oklahoma
Oscar Adaway, South Carolina
Arion Carter, Tennessee
Liona Lefau, Texas
Ar’maj Reed-Adams, Texas A&M
Bryan Longwell, Vanderbilt
